Screen Scraping
Screen Scraping is the technique of extracting data from the screen display of legacy systems where APIs or other methods of data retrieval are not available.
Orchestration
Orchestration in RPA is the coordinated management of multiple bots and processes, often involving an orchestration tool to ensure that tasks are carried out seamlessly and efficiently.
MetaBots
MetaBots in Automation Anywhere are the building blocks for scalable automation, allowing users to create reusable automation components that can be used across multiple applications and tasks.
Intelligent Document Processing (IDP)
Intelligent Document Processing (IDP) combines RPA with AI to capture, extract and process data from various document types, including those with unstructured formats like emails and images.
Exception Handling
Exception Handling in RPA refers to defining what happens when an error or unprecedented event occurs during a bot's operation, ensuring the process can continue or stop gracefully.
Unattended Automation
Unattended Automation involves RPA bots that operate without human intervention. They can be scheduled or triggered by events and usually handle batch processes.
Digital Workforce
In RPA, the Digital Workforce refers to a pool of bots designed to work alongside humans to enhance productivity and efficiency. They can be scaled up or down according to demand.
Natural Language Processing (NLP)
Natural Language Processing (NLP) in RPA is the integration of the ability to understand and process human language, which allows bots to perform tasks such as chat interactions or processing unstructured data.
RPA Developer
An RPA Developer is a professional responsible for designing, developing, and implementing RPA systems. They write automation scripts and ensure the bots function correctly within a workflow.
RPA
Robotic Process Automation (RPA) is the technology that allows anyone to configure computer software to emulate and integrate the actions of a human interacting within digital systems to execute a business process.
Process Mining
Process Mining is a technique that uses specialized data mining algorithms to analyze business processes based on event logs and find bottlenecks or inefficiencies that can be automated.
Programming Logic
In RPA, Programming Logic refers to the set of instructions that determine how the software bots will automate tasks. It includes decision-making, looping, and branching.
Computer Vision
Computer Vision in RPA is the use of machine learning algorithms to interpret and understand the visual information from a computer screen in order to automate tasks that require visual cognition.
Bot
In RPA, a bot is a software application that is programmed to do certain tasks automatically. They are commonly used to automate repetitive tasks that are rule-based and involve structured data.
Workflow Automation
Workflow Automation is the use of RPA tools to create a sequence of tasks that lead to the execution of a complex business process without human intervention.
Scalability
Scalability in RPA refers to the ability to increase or decrease the number of bots running to meet the processing needs of the business quickly and with minimal impact on operations.
UiPath
UiPath is a leading RPA tool used to automate Windows desktop applications. It provides a platform for organizations to efficiently automate business processes.
RPA Governance
RPA Governance is the framework for managing and monitoring the robotic process automation environment within an organization, ensuring the RPA strategy aligns with business objectives and compliance standards.
Cognitive Automation
Cognitive Automation refers to the next stage of RPA that involves adding layers of intelligent processing using AI technologies, enabling bots to handle complex and non-standardized tasks.
AI and Machine Learning
AI and Machine Learning in RPA involve using advanced algorithms to enable bots to handle complex tasks, learn from data patterns, and improve over time, thus extending RPA capabilities.
Automation Anywhere
Automation Anywhere is an RPA tool that enables businesses to automate end-to-end business operations for increased efficiency. It uses software bots to automate repetitive tasks.
Selectors
Selectors are RPA elements that uniquely identify objects or elements on a user interface, such as buttons or text fields, allowing bots to interact with them accurately during the automation.
Work Queue
In RPA, a Work Queue is a collection of tasks that need to be completed by bots. It enables load leveling and is often used to distribute tasks among multiple bots.
Attended Automation
Attended Automation refers to a scenario where RPA bots work alongside human employees, assisting them with tasks when required. These bots are usually invoked by the user.
Desktop Automation
Desktop Automation refers to the automation of tasks on a single computer or desktop, as opposed to server or web-based automation. It's used for personal or small-scale automation projects.
Blue Prism
Blue Prism is an RPA software that allows for the automation of manual, rule-based, back-office administrative processes, creating a virtual workforce powered by software robots.
Process Discovery
Process Discovery is the phase in RPA where potential processes for automation are identified and documented. This involves assessing the current workflow to determine a business case for RPA.
Scripting Language
Scripting Language in RPA is used to write scripts or small programs that can automate tasks. Common scripting languages in RPA include VBScript, JavaScript, and Python.
Task Bots
Task Bots are RPA bots designed to perform repetitive and routine tasks using rule-based operations. They can complete tasks such as data entry, form filling, and simple data manipulations.
Recorders
Recorders in RPA are tools that capture user actions on the interface, such as clicking and typing, to generate automation scripts which can be replayed or customized.
